Output e528d42f9aaf89d2b7d6278001ba145ed910886086604447d1684f8a01266be7:1

value
30886809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 631342c2e52b0c201e1a6fe963ddb9ee71a11fc7 OP_EQUAL
address
3AistoEGMoKgY5RYsumJzGVAqy7SryaDUH
transaction
e528d42f9aaf89d2b7d6278001ba145ed910886086604447d1684f8a01266be7
spent
true